How many people live in Chandler, Texas?
Chandler, Texas has about 1,630 residents according to the 1990 Census.
What is the median household income in Chandler, Texas?
The typical household in Chandler, Texas earns about $25,286 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Chandler, Texas expensive?
In Chandler, Texas, the median home is worth about $57,400, and the typical rent is about $407 a month.
How educated are people in Chandler, Texas?
About 13.2% of adults age 25 and over in Chandler, Texas h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Chandler, Texas?
About 15.9% of people in Chandler, Texas live below the federal poverty line.
